Summary:
The Complex Welder is responsible for executing advanced welding tasks on a variety of metals, such as stainless steel, nickel alloy, and more. The role necessitates a comprehensive understanding of diverse welding techniques in various positions, including vertical, horizontal, and overhead.

Essential Functions:

  • Skilled in GMAW, FCAW, and GTAW welding processes.
  • Can handle traditional projects and execute most fit-ups as per company's requirements.
  • Proficient in advanced blueprint reading and interpretation of welding symbols.
  • Operates independently on a routine basis, with reliable judgment.
  • Ensures tasks are completed within the specified timeframes.
